Fort Collins Real Estate- Bank Owned Homes
Bank Owned Homes
One of our steadiest clients is Premiere Asset Services/Wells Fargo. We list a fair number of foreclosed
homes for them. In the past they were more apt to do a simple sales clean and then get the homes on
the market.
Lately, their strategy has changed. They are now aggressively appealing to the owner occupant market
by not only cleaning but replacing carpet, painting, even up-dating kitchens and baths to make homes
move-in ready. This is great news for owner occupant buyers who aren’t handy but terrible news for
investor buyers or those owner occupant buyers who are looking for the opportunity to earn some
sweat equity.
But don’t despair. This is just one company’s policy. Citi, HUD, FannieMae and others still market fixers.
Investors out there are just going to have to look a little harder.
Fort Collins Real Estate- Short Sales
After months of patience on the part of my buyer and absolutely no word from the bank we were told
that we’d been assigned a negotiator. Yipeee! I got the feeling that our offer was worth looking at and
hadn’t been tossed in the bin. And then we waited.
A week or two went by when the negotiator asked for a refreshed lender letter. I read that as a good
sign. My buyer supplied the letter within a couple of days as required by the negotiator. And then we
waited.
More time goes by…I have a very patient buyer…when suddenly we were presented with a counter-
proposal. OK…I could deal with that. So I opened the email attachment and was shocked to see that the
counter was tens of thousands more than the list price!!! We’re talking about a home that’s priced in
the $200’s, not a super high end home.
Yeah, my buyer had offered low…he’s an investor who had to factor in the cost of repairs, holding
expenses and the cost of marketing along with a little bit of profit.
Obviously this wasn’t a pre-approved short-sale. If it had been, the negotiator would have had a say in
the pricing and a negotiator would have been in communication with the listing agent from day one.
In addition the property had two loans against it. Apparently, the two lenders were at odds with each
other with the second wanting more. That’s why the counter came back so high.
So, if you decide to go after a short sale you might want to ask the listing agent if the short-sale has
been pre-approved and if s/he has been assigned a negotiator and if there is more than one loan on the
property. The best and easiest short sales are the ones that have only one loan, have been pre-approved
and have a negotiator assigned at the time the property is placed on the market.
Good luck and be patient if you intend to buy a short-sale.
Fort Collins Real Estate- Foreclosure Activity in Larimer County
Since November 1st of 2011 there have been 65 new foreclosure listings in Larimer county. A number of these were vacant lots in Wellington, part of the Park Meadows subdivision. This puts the price range of the active foreclosures all over the board from $50k to $1,500,000. The high end of this range is the Auburn Estates subdivison, currently under short sale agreement. Average days on market is 35 with an average price of $223,270.
Sold comps from this same time frame total 66 properties. So the supply is above even with demand which is to be expected as the number of foreclosure properties has fallen in the last few years and has created a short fall. The values for the solds range from $12,500 to $925,000. The lower end of values includes lot sales in the Park Meadows subdivision in Wellington. Days on market average 87 with an average value of $188,151. The average value is pulled down by the very low sale price of the vacant lots. If you remove the lots the average value comes up to $205,717, more inline with what is expected for the greater Larimer county area.

Fort Collins Real Estate, Mason Corridor Progress
The Mason street corridor has been in the works for some time. City officials see this North to South road as the next Harmony Corridor. With commercial, residential and retail projects up and down this area. To help vitalize this area the plans include large public transportation infrastructure combined with bike and walking paths to attract residents. A major part of this project is to open Mason street to 2 way traffic where now its a one way North. Work on this part of the project has begun with adding the infrastructure for street lights, train crossings and pedestrian traffic. The next major part of work will involve rebuilding the railroad tracks, this will close Mason street for a week during construction. The majority of this new corridor, stretching from Harmony Rd to Cherry St, will be available only too the MAX bus transit system. The transit system is slated to be complete in 2014.
